What are your contributions to the team?

During your internship, you will contribute to…

Support reliability data collection improvement process to ensure a high level of data accuracy and completeness.

Update and document processes and procedures as required.

You will develop the following skills:

Understand aerospace reliability and maintenance cost data and metrics

Understand of Customer Support processes within the Aerospace context

Knowledge of data collection and data management processes and constraints

Knowledge of aircraft configuration

Project management of a multi-phase project

Communication skills to satisfy various stakeholders including department managers

Hands on experience with various tools including troubleshooting complex applications

Understanding of aircraft reliability metrics and data

How to thrive in this role?

Students currently completing a degree in Industrial, Mechanical, Electrical or Aerospace Engineering.

Students who have completed a minimum of 2 years of studies in this program.

Students who have strong analytical abilities.

Students who have in-depth technical knowledge of Microsoft Suite products.

Students who have a strong understanding of how to manipulate data in MS Excel as required or with VBA or Python.

Students who have can create queries and filters in MS Access or SQL, for the purpose of engineering data analysis.

Students who possess excellent communication (English required), presentation and interpersonal skills.

Highly motivated team players with a sense of responsibility and good judgment.
